Output d32fe44196b9458b528b7a4fd806426f8c29daab845ecff387af7965dc81fd24:0

value
6956003856102
script pubkey
OP_0 OP_PUSHBYTES_20 c351c4b2271551bca233583cc473a8acdd5856d3
address
tb1qcdgufv38z4gmeg3ntq7vguag4nw4s4knvw7n83
transaction
d32fe44196b9458b528b7a4fd806426f8c29daab845ecff387af7965dc81fd24
spent
true